Output d5d3173bf29b4d6d1870b766ff04a04f512d21f18697e1a9c92ac59de41a4390:1

value
791036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ac9cab293e6a8e863e69f0d4bb42c13b74a3dc7 OP_EQUAL
address
39y4UYieNAmBDSNn2vhixVJSs3SqAKH31T
transaction
d5d3173bf29b4d6d1870b766ff04a04f512d21f18697e1a9c92ac59de41a4390
confirmations
107188
spent
true